Transgression Definition
transgression
- noun
- the act of transgressing; the violation of a law or a duty or moral principle; "the boy was punished for the transgressions of his father"
- the spreading of the sea over land as evidenced by the deposition of marine strata over terrestrial strata
- the action of going beyond or overstepping some boundary or limit
